An event that is impossible or improbable has a probability of zero, as explained. The probability ranges from 0 to 1, as explained.In statistics, the likelihood of an impossibility is equal to zero. E = 0 and P(E) = 0 for an impossibility, respectively. For instance, there is no chance of drawing a green ball from a set of red balls because it is impossible to draw a green ball when there are only red balls in the set.It is impossible for something to happen if the probability is zero. And if the probability is one, the event is guaranteed to occur. We have a 50-50 or even chance in the middle of these. Any value above this is considered likely, and any value below this is considered unlikely.There is no chance for an event to occur if it is impossible. It won’t ever occur. If something is unlikely, it has a slim chance of occurring. To say something is likely means there is a good chance it will occur.There is zero chance that something will happen. A situation like this is referred to as an impossible event.
